About TADAWUL:4030

The National Shipping Company of Saudi Arabia, together with its subsidiaries, purchases, sells, and operates vessels for the transportation of cargo in the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ia. The company operates in four segments: Transportation of Oil; Transportation of Chemicals; Logistics; and Transportation of Dry Bulk. It transports crude oil and petrochemical products; and provides technical ship management and logistics services. Financial Performance

In 2025, TADAWUL:4030's revenue was 10.35 billion, an increase of 9.12% compared to the previous year's 9.48 billion. Earnings were 2.43 billion, an increase of 12.07%.
